Technical Field
[0001] This invention relates to the field of sensor technology, and in particular to a protective device for a non-contact current sensor. Background Technology
[0002] With the development of industrial automation and intelligence, current sensors are increasingly widely used in energy, power, and various industrial equipment. However, in harsh environments such as high humidity, high temperature, and dust, existing current sensors struggle to meet the high reliability and accuracy requirements for long-term stable operation. Their waterproof and dustproof performance is insufficient, and the commonly used enclosed structures and traditional heat dissipation designs result in poor heat dissipation. Furthermore, the cable center position of non-contact current sensors has a significant impact on measurement results and lacks precise positioning methods. Specifically, while the eddy current sensor in patent 202411924575.2 uses a dustproof plate and enclosed shell... While achieving waterproof and dustproof performance, the lack of an effective heat dissipation mechanism makes it prone to overheating at high temperatures, leading to insufficient stability. The Hall current sensor in patent 201910777675.X combines heat dissipation and cable positioning, but it suffers from defects such as large manual positioning errors, long oscillation time, and insufficient waterproof and dustproof protection. Although the waterproof and corrosion-resistant design in patent 202410993377.5 can block moisture and dust, it does not effectively solve the heat dissipation problem, and long-term use can easily lead to dust accumulation, affecting heat dissipation. Existing current sensors cannot simultaneously meet the requirements of waterproof, dustproof, heat dissipation, and cable positioning, making it difficult to operate stably for a long time in harsh environments. Summary of the Invention
[0003] In view of the above-mentioned problems of existing non-contact current sensors, such as insufficient waterproof and dustproof performance, low heat dissipation efficiency, low cable positioning accuracy, and poor overall structural reliability in harsh environments such as high temperature, high humidity, and dust, this invention is proposed.
[0004] Therefore, the purpose of this invention is to provide a protective device for a non-contact current sensor.
[0005] To solve the above-mentioned technical problems, the present invention provides the following technical solution: a protective device for a non-contact current sensor, comprising, The system includes a sealing assembly and a flow assembly. The sealing assembly comprises a first layer, a damping component, and a PCB board. The first layer, from the outside to the inside, consists of a hydrophobic and waterproof layer, a first rigid anti-corrosion plastic layer, a first metal shielding layer, a second rigid anti-corrosion plastic layer, a second metal shielding layer, and a third rigid anti-corrosion plastic layer. The damping component includes a first elastic layer and a second elastic layer. The PCB board includes a magnetic induction board, a computing circuit board, and an energy recovery board. The sealing assembly as a whole has a ten-layer structure from the outside to the inside, consisting of a hydrophobic and waterproof layer, a first rigid anti-corrosion plastic layer, a first metal shielding layer, a second rigid anti-corrosion plastic layer, a second metal shielding layer, a first elastic layer, a PCB board, a second elastic layer, a third rigid anti-corrosion plastic layer, and a hydrophobic and waterproof layer. Among them, the hydrophobic waterproof layer provides waterproof barrier between the inner and outer layers, the rigid anti-corrosion plastic layer ensures structural rigidity and corrosion resistance, the metal shielding layer resists electromagnetic interference, the elastic layer plays a role in shock absorption and sealing, and the three types of PCB boards respectively undertake the functions of magnetic induction detection, calculation control and energy recovery. The ten-layer structure works together to achieve waterproofing, dustproofing, anti-interference, shock absorption and core function support, providing a basic guarantee for the stable operation of the sensor.

[0031] Specifically, the magnetic induction plate 131 and the energy recovery plate 133 are inlaid with the magnetic induction sensor 231 and the breathable membrane 232 of the flow component 2, and the magnetic induction sensor 231 and the breathable membrane 232 are evenly distributed on the annular plate; the computing circuit board 132 is inlaid with the breathable membrane 232, the fan 233, the first motor 234, the second motor 235, the third motor 236 and the temperature sensor 237, the breathable membrane 232 and the fan 233 are evenly distributed on the annular plate, the first motor 234 is located on the left side of the fan 233, and the second motor 235 is located near the airflow channel 22 of the flow component 2; The hydrophobic and waterproof layer 111 is made of fluorocarbon polymer coating with a thickness of approximately 0.5 mm. It has self-healing properties and can automatically restore its integrity after minor scratches. The first rigid anti-corrosion plastic layer 112 is made of polyetheretherketone (PEEK) material with a thickness of 1 mm, which has high mechanical strength and chemical corrosion resistance. The first metal shielding layer 113 is made of permalloy sheet with a thickness of 0.3 mm for electromagnetic shielding. The second rigid anti-corrosion plastic layer 114 is made of the same material as the first rigid layer, further enhancing the structural rigidity. The second metal shielding layer 115 is made of the same material as the first metal shielding layer 113, forming a double-layer electromagnetic shielding structure. The first elastic layer... Layer 121 is made of silicone rubber with a thickness of 2mm and is used for shock absorption and sealing. The PCB board 13 includes a magnetic induction board 131, a computing circuit board 132, and an energy recovery board 133. The boards are electrically interconnected through flexible connectors. The second elastic layer 122 is made of the same material as the first elastic layer 121 and wraps and buffers the internal PCB board 13. The third rigid anti-corrosion plastic layer 116 serves as an inner lining structure to maintain the overall shape. The innermost hydrophobic and waterproof layer 111 is sprayed with polyurethane waterproof paint to achieve the innermost sealing protection. The layers are formed by hot-pressing composite process, and the overall structure has good toughness and environmental isolation performance.

The airflow channel 2224 is located inside the sensor housing and runs through three types of PCB boards 13. The breathable membranes 232, made of ePTFE material, are embedded in the magnetic induction plate 131 and the energy recovery plate 133, with six breathable membrane units evenly distributed on each plate. Four miniature brushless fans 233 are embedded in the computing circuit board 132 and are evenly distributed circumferentially. The fan shaft 222 is connected to the output of the first motor 234, allowing for speed adjustment. A temperature sensor 237 is attached to the inner wall of the computing circuit board 132 to monitor the internal temperature in real time and transmit the signal to the control unit. A rotating plate 221 is located on the outermost side of the airflow channel 22, and its shaft 222 is connected to the output of the second motor 235. The second motor 235 controls the opening and closing angle of the rotating plate 221 based on the feedback signal from the temperature sensor 237, thereby adjusting the cross-sectional area of the airflow channel 22 and achieving intelligent control of heat dissipation intensity.

Four identical positioning components 3 are evenly distributed circumferentially within the sensor cavity. Each positioning component 3 includes a telescopic rod 31, a support plate 32, and a position sensor. The telescopic rod 31 contains a spring 311 and a lead screw transmission mechanism. The third motor 236 drives the lead screw to achieve radial movement of the positioning component 3. The support plate 32 is an arc-shaped aluminum alloy part with a soft rubber pad 33 made of fluororubber attached to its inner arc surface. This pad provides friction when clamping the cable and prevents damage to the cable surface. The position sensor is embedded inside the support plate 32 and is used to detect the offset between the cable and the center of the sensor in real time. The control unit receives the position sensor signal, generates control commands through a PID algorithm, and drives the third motor 236 to rotate, thereby achieving dynamic fine-tuning of the cable position and ensuring that the cable is always at the geometric center of the sensor.

After the sensor is powered on, it operates according to the following procedure: (1) Initial state: Each motor is in standby state, the fan 233 runs at low speed, the rotating plate 221 opens at an angle of 30%, and the positioning component 3 is in the center position. (2) Temperature monitoring and heat dissipation regulation: Temperature sensor 237 monitors the internal temperature in real time. When the temperature is below 40℃, the system maintains the initial state; when the temperature reaches 40℃ (first threshold), the first motor 234 increases the speed of fan 233 to enhance forced air cooling; when the temperature reaches 55℃ (second threshold), the second motor 235 operates to open the rotating plate 221 to the maximum angle (90%) to achieve maximum airflow heat dissipation; at the same time, if the temperature continues to rise to 70℃ (third threshold), the control unit issues an overheat alarm signal and can link with the upper-level system to reduce the measurement current; (3) Cable position calibration: The position sensor monitors the cable position in real time. If the cable is detected to be deviated from the center by more than 0.5mm, the control unit starts the third motor 236 to drive the corresponding positioning component 3 to move and reposition the cable to the center area within 3 seconds. (4) Waterproof and dustproof: The multi-layer composite structure effectively isolates external moisture and dust throughout the entire working process. Even in rainy or dusty environments, the internal PCB board 13 can remain dry and clean, ensuring measurement accuracy.
